LONDON (Reuters) - England winger Christian Wade was ruled out of the Six Nations on Monday after suffering a serious left foot injury playing for Wasps in Saturday's Premiership victory over London Irish.

Wade, 22, will be sidelined for up to six months, Wasps confirmed on their website (www.wasps.co.uk), adding that he required surgery to repair "significant ligament damage."
